For a "Happy Anniversary" balloon decoration, you can create a romantic, celebratory atmosphere to honor the couple's special day. Here are some ideas for incorporating balloons into an anniversary celebration:

1. "Happy Anniversary" Balloon Banner

  • Design: Use large foil balloons to spell out “Happy Anniversary” in elegant colors like gold, silver, or rose gold. You can also mix these with heart-shaped or star-shaped balloons for added visual appeal.

  • Location: Hang the banner above the couple’s table, near the entrance, or as a backdrop for photos.

2. Anniversary Balloon Arch

  • Design: Create a balloon arch with the couple's favorite colors or anniversary-themed colors like gold, white, and black. You can add accents like flowers or fairy lights to make it extra special.

  • Location: Place the arch at the entrance to the venue or above the couple’s seating area as a welcoming feature.

3. Balloon Centerpieces

  • Design: Use balloon bouquets as centerpieces. You can combine heart-shaped balloons, metallic balloons, and flowers for a romantic touch. Add a “Happy Anniversary” sign or message to personalize it.

  • Location: Place them on dining tables, the cake table, or around the venue for a celebratory feel.

4. Balloon Wall or Photo Backdrop

  • Design: Create a photo booth backdrop with balloons in anniversary colors. Add letters, numbers, or heart-shaped balloons to spell out the anniversary year or a sweet message like “Forever Love” or “Mr. & Mrs.”

  • Location: Place this in a corner or against a wall, allowing guests to take photos in front of it.

5. Anniversary Balloon Bouquets

  • Design: Create a beautiful bouquet of balloons with “Happy Anniversary” foil balloons, mixed with smaller heart-shaped or star-shaped balloons. Consider using gold, silver, or pastel colors.

  • Location: Display these on entry tables, the couple's seat, or in strategic locations around the venue.

6. Balloon Floating Lights

  • Design: Use clear balloons with small LED lights inside to create a soft glow. You can even add confetti inside the balloons to make them sparkle.

  • Location: Hang them from the ceiling or use them around the cake table or dance floor for a romantic, glowing atmosphere.

7. "Love" Balloon Decor

  • Design: Use heart-shaped balloons or create a “LOVE” sign with large letter balloons. You can add accents like lace, ribbons, or artificial flowers to complement the decor.

  • Location: Place them near the couple, on the dance floor, or on the reception table.

8. Anniversary Balloon Ceiling Installation

  • Design: Hang balloons from the ceiling in the shape of hearts or clusters of gold and white balloons. Adding fairy lights or streamers can enhance the effect.

  • Location: Above the reception area or dance floor, to create a festive and romantic atmosphere.

9. Balloon Cake Topper

  • Design: For a playful touch, use small balloons or a “Happy Anniversary” balloon to top the anniversary cake. You can use balloons in different colors or shapes to match the theme.

  • Location: On top of the anniversary cake or dessert table.

10. Anniversary Balloon Columns

  • Design: Create elegant balloon columns with metallic or pastel-colored balloons. You can add small heart or star-shaped balloons at the top or base for extra flair.

  • Location: Place them near the entrance or along the aisle for a grand touch.

These "Happy Anniversary" balloon decorations are a fun, festive way to celebrate the couple’s journey together, creating a memorable and joyful atmosphere for their special day!
